When Women Lost Their Tails (1972)

A Nostalgic Look at One Million B.C.

When Women Lost Their Tails (1972) poster

Filli and the cavemen from "When Women Had Tails" are living a carefree life inside a dinosaur skeleton. But when conman Ham introduces them to the concept of currency and economics, their lives fall apart. On top of that, Filli starts to fall in love with Ham.

Director: Pasquale Festa Campanile
Genre: Comedy
Runtime: 94 min

Music: Ennio Morricone, Bruno Nicolai
Cinematography: Silvano Ippoliti
Editing: Gertrud Petermann, Nino Baragli
Production: Clesi Cinematografica, Terra-Filmkunst
Country: Germany, Italy
Language: Italiano
